Here's how you can remove those shortcut arrows from your desktop icons in Windows XP.
1. Start regedit.
2. Navigate to H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\lnkfile
3. Delete the IsShortcut registry value.
You may need to restart Windows XP.
Word of caution when editting the registry, it is a good idea to back up the registry before making any changes.
